Job Summary and Qualifications
The Finance Director will play an important role on the Research service line team, providing financial leadership to a growing service line that is across 50+ sites. With more than 600 active studies, this position will advise and lead on strategies and tactics to effectively and efficiently grow the business. The Director will report to the Controller and work directly with the VP of Research and CFO to leverage the capabilities of the operations team to help with managing the budget, operating results, forecasting needs, analysis of acquisition opportunities, and analysis to support healthcare reimbursement and vendor negotiations. This person will be responsible for the implementation of new processes that will improve our ability to make strong financial decisions.
This role is based in office in Brentwood, TN.
Job Summary:
- Manage financial operations and provide strategic direction as it relates to the HRI service line, which includes 54 sites with more than 600 studies.
- Lead strategic planning for the Research service line, identifying opportunities to improve revenue and reduce operating expenses, leveraging the operations teams to execute service line profitability
- Ensure timeliness, accuracy and completeness of financial reports and projects to meet specified deadlines.
- Supervise, evaluate, and train a team of financial managers, senior financial analyst, and business analyst positions
- Present to and work with Hospital & Division CFOs on all financial related initiatives concerning the Research service line.
- Support contract negotiations related to business partners, suppliers, and customers
- Partner with accounting support teams to collaborate on billing and revenue cycle management.
- Own monthly reporting process and present monthly analysis on the financial statements to division leadership and Research leadership
- Utilize statistical, economic, and financial principles and techniques to prepare reports such as pro formas, projections and other ad hoc requests.
- Oversee and execute the preparation and implementation of budgets, forecasts and analysis for all sites and overhead operations.
- Engage and manage relationships across the enterprise with other business units, including but not limited to: accounting, financial reporting, HR, benefits, information technology and reimbursement.
